High-quality visuals capture attention, while fast-loading media retains visitors. Search engines and AI-driven recommendation systems increasingly evaluate pages on performance metrics such as Core Web Vitals, which include Largest Contentful Paint and Cumulative Layout Shift. Optimized images and videos not only improve load times but also boost SEO, user engagement, and conversion rates.

Video content demands higher bandwidth and more sophisticated handling. AI technologies address these challenges in several ways:
Here’s an example table comparing traditional vs AI-powered video workflows:
Feature | Traditional | AI-Powered |
Encoding | Manual presets | Dynamic ML profiles |
Thumbnail Selection | User-chosen frame | AI-driven best shot |
Streaming | Fixed bitrate | Adaptive ABR |
